Last Devils Game
On Saturday afternoon, the Devils won their 4th game in row, defeating the Edmonton Oilers by a score of 5-3. Yes, for the first time since 2023, the Devils won 4 games in row. Yes, I can’t believe it either. It was a fantastic game. Jesper Bratt had a goal and an assist. Connor Brown had a gorgeous short handed goal against his former team. Nico “El Capitan” Hischier had 2 assists, and “everyone’s” favorite whipping boy Jack Hughes put up 2 beautiful goals and an assist. Even the actual whipping boy,
Dawson Mercer put up a goal. Back to back wins against the 2 teams that were in the Stanley Cup finals last year AND their first 4 game win streak of the season. What more could one ask for?

Sheldon Keefe Will Have His Revenge on Seattle Toronto
Sheldon Keefe spent 5 seasons as the coach of the Toronto Maple Leafs from 2019/20 to 2023/24 before becoming the head coach of the New Jersey Devils last year. The Devils played the Maple Leafs 3 times last season, losing all 3 games. As of tonight, Keefe is still looking for his first win as a head coach against his former team.
